Chiltern 50 Ultra Challenge
The Chiltern 50 Ultra Challenge is a looped trail event taking place on Saturday, 26 September 2026. The start and finish point is the Henley Showground basecamp in Henley.
Participants can choose from multiple distances:
- 50 km with approximately 920 meters of elevation.
- 25 km with approximately 500 meters of elevation.
- 10 km with approximately 235 meters of elevation.
The route passes through Chilterns countryside, featuring historic trails, rolling hills, nature reserves, and varied scenery. It is described as easily accessible from London.
The event includes several support services. Food and drink are provided at rest stops approximately every 12.5 km, with main meals at larger stops. The route is marked with signage and GPS tracking is available via a mobile app. Medical, podiatry, and massage teams are present at rest stops.
On-site facilities at the Henley basecamp include a Saturday night celebration meal, a bar, camping options, and parking. Shuttle bus transfers to and from the nearest train station are available.
Participants can enter as individuals or teams. Specific start categories include a Solo Challenger start time for individuals wanting to meet others. For 2026, there is a new Ultra Trailblazerz category for competitive runners aiming for specific time goals, and an Ultra March category for walkers aiming to complete 50 km in under 12 hours or 100 km in under 24 hours.
Registration options include self-funding or fundraising for a charity. Finishers receive a medal, a t-shirt, and a glass of fizz. Visit the organization's website for the most recent information.
